As mentioned in previous posts loading and unloading can be somewhat annoying on the New Models but can be corrected which will also allow the cylinder to freewheel clockwise or counter clockwise. If you shoot heavy lead bullets the short cylinder of the Black Hawk or Super Black Hawk can become an issue, and if you shoot heavy lead bullets(300 + grain) at upper power levels the squared trigger guard becomes objectional to many shooters. An option which you may want to look at is the Bisley as it has the rounded trigger guard and some say it manages recoil better. You may want to look at the 45 Colt as it offers several advantages such as a larger frontal area, heavier bullets at higher velocities at much Lower pressures. Hope this helps.
